RodjER talked about his immediate career plans

Vladimir 'RodjER' Nikoghosyan is not planning to play in professional Dota 2 teams in the near future, as he wants to focus on streaming and promises to cover the upcoming BLAST Slam I tournament.

The corresponding statement was made by the player on Twitch.

“I don't plan to be on any teams. I plan to stream. And my plans are to community-cast BLAST. I'll be casting BLAST, so there will be a schedule soon.”

Vladimir 'RodjER' Nikoghosyan has been inactive since leaving the L1ga Team in February of this year, where he stayed for less than a month. Since then, the former professional cyber athlete has been actively engaged in streaming, but did not rule out the possibility of continuing his career, and also stated in one of the streams that success on the pro scene is possible at any age.
